The Viral Gaming Meltdown That Captured Millions

When technical failures transform gaming enjoyment into digital purgatory, the resulting player reactions often become internet sensations. This phenomenon recently unfolded spectacularly when a L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ga player documented their descent into gaming despair through a viral TikTok video that resonated with millions.

L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ga delivers an accessible adventure experience, yet one particular gameplay session devolved into digital torment when a progression-blocking glitch created an inescapable mission loop.

The enduring partnership between Star Wars and LEGO gaming has spanned multiple console generations, culminating in The Skywalker Saga’s comprehensive reimagining of all nine core films. Our evaluation praised its ambitious scope and engaging mechanics, noting its particular appeal to content creators and streaming audiences. However, technical imperfections occasionally surface, as demonstrated by TikTok creator thesaintglizzy’s encounter with a mission-breaking anomaly that transformed gameplay into frustration.

Anatomy of the Endor Forest Game-Breaking Bug

Content creator thesaintglizzy maintains an active gaming-focused TikTok presence with approximately 1,000 dedicated followers, regularly sharing experiences from titles like Elden Ring and the LEGO Star Wars franchise.

During the Return of the Jedi segment’s Endor forest sequence, players receive the straightforward objective: “Defeat the attacking Scout Troopers!” However, the gaming session deteriorated when essential enemy spawns failed to trigger, creating an unwinnable mission state despite repeated attempts.

    “The developers responsible for this malfunctioning mission segment need to implement immediate corrections,” the frustrated player exclaimed during their recording. “I’ve remained trapped at this identical checkpoint for multiple hours regardless of how frequently I reset the level. Each attempt concludes identically when reaching the defeat scout troopers phase.” The gamer’s escalating agitation rendered subsequent commentary increasingly incoherent before their final summation: “I’m completely out of solutions here – I’ve accumulated 800 million studs through gameplay, yet the necessary Scout Trooper adversaries remain conspicuously absent!”

    Avoiding Similar Gaming Frustrations: Pro Tips

    Encountering progression-blocking bugs represents one of gaming’s most frustrating experiences, but strategic approaches can mitigate these situations:

    Multiple Save Management: Maintain rotating save files rather than relying on a single save slot. When encountering potential glitches, revert to a slightly earlier save point rather than repeatedly attempting the same bugged segment.

    Community Consultation: Before assuming user error, consult gaming forums and community resources. Previous players often document workarounds for known issues, including specific sequence triggers or alternative approaches to problematic objectives.

    Mission Restart Protocol: Completely exit and reload the mission rather than continuing from checkpoint restarts. Some glitches resolve through complete mission resets that clear temporary memory issues.

    Character Switching: Experiment with different character selections during problematic sequences. Certain gameplay triggers may respond differently to alternative character abilities or interactions.

    Update Verification: Ensure game installations include the latest patches and updates. Developers frequently address known issues through post-release support, making current versions less prone to documented bugs.
